Meaning of Debate
According to Merriam-Webster, "debate" refers to a discussion or argument, especially one that is formal or public, between two or more people with different opinions or views.
Definitions
- The Oxford English Dictionary defines "debate" as a formal discussion on a particular matter in a public meeting or legislative assembly, especially one in which opposing views are presented.
- The Cambridge Dictionary defines "debate" as a serious discussion of a subject, especially one in which there is disagreement, or a formal discussion of a subject in which people express different opinions.
Example Uses
- The two candidates engaged in a heated debate about the economy and healthcare.
- The students participated in a debate competition, discussing topics such as climate change and social justice.
- The company held a debate on the new marketing strategy, with some employees arguing in favor and others against.
- The professor encouraged her students to debate the merits of the novel, exploring its themes and symbolism.
- The community held a public debate on the proposed development project, with residents expressing their concerns and opinions.
